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8922656 8027174065 08262
02935916 8265421948 459337
02935916 8265421948 459337
72212 83 87087142 83107
All about undefined
Interested in learning more?
02935916 8265421948 459337
72212 83 87087142 83107
See more
210873199 83053 42
6468316212 188369 006101 9694
See more
683 8585
6951 64 437522036
See more